Children’s Vaccines
Any child who is 18 years of age or younger and meets at least one of the eligibility criteria listed below is eligible for the Texas Vaccines for Children program.
- Medicaid eligible
- Enrolled in Children’s Health Insurance Program (CHIP) and the provider bills CHIP for the services
- Is an American Indian or Alaskan Native
- Does not have health insurance or is underinsured
The charge for children eligible for the Texas Vaccines for Children program is $5.00 per vaccine.

Adult’s Vaccines
The Adult Safety Net (ASN) Program provides vaccines purchased with public funds to participating clinics to be used for immunizing uninsured adults. The vaccines are available for adults 19 years of age or older that do not have health insurance. The cost is $5.00 per vaccine
